嘻哈C#---SMTP发送邮件

using System;
using System.Collections.Generic;
using System.Drawing;
using System.Windows.Forms;
using System.Net.Mail ;
namespace smtpmail
{
	/// <summary>
	/// Description of MainForm.
	/// </summary>
	public partial class MainForm : Form
	{
		public MainForm()
		{
			//
			// The InitializeComponent() call is required for Windows Forms designer support.
			//
			InitializeComponent();
			
			//
			// TODO: Add constructor code after the InitializeComponent() call.
			//
		}
		
		void Button1Click(object sender, EventArgs e)
		{
			MailAddress from=new MailAddress(text_from.Text,"ceshi");
			MailMessage mail=new MailMessage();
			mail.Subject=textBox1.Text;
            mail.To.Add(textto.Text);
            mail.Body=textbody.Text;
            mail.BodyEncoding = System.Text.Encoding.UTF8;
            if(checkBox1.Checked==true)
            {
            	 mail.IsBodyHtml = true;
            }
            else
            {
            	 mail.IsBodyHtml = false;
            }
            mail.Priority = MailPriority.Normal;
            mail.From=from ;
            SmtpClient client = new SmtpClient();
            client.Host=text_smtp.Text ;
            client.Port = 25;
            client.UseDefaultCredentials = false;
            client.Credentials = new System.Net.NetworkCredential(text_from.Text, textfrompass.Text);
            client.DeliveryMethod = SmtpDeliveryMethod.Network;
            client.Send(mail);
            MessageBox.Show("发送成功,一般情况几秒后即可收到");
			
		}
	}
}
 
 


猜你喜欢

转载自blog.csdn.net/chencong5025/article/details/7437424